Today we had a visit from environmentalist and artist, Gordon Darcy. He did nature drawing workshops with all pupils in the school, starting with the junior classes who drew ladybirds, fish and snails! After break, the senior classes went on a field trip to Ross Abbey to look at the natural environment around the friary. They were also lucky enough to see a fox and a hare in the fields! When they came back they also had an art workshop, and drew some of the things they had seen on their excursion! Follow the link below to see more images from the day.
